Madonna plays Santa for Malawi orphans

Washington , Tue, 28 Dec 2010 ANI

Washington, Dec 28 (ANI): Queen of Pop Madonna, who was unable to visit Malawi this Christmas, played Santa Claus for the kids in the six orphanages she funds there by sending them gifts.

 

Boxes of toys, chocolate, other sweets and clothes were shipped with a handwritten note from the star, which read, "To my Malawi children on Christmas and Boxing Day. I wish I was with you. See you soon M," reports People mag.

 

Inside the goodie boxes were miniature Christmas cards signed by Madonna, Lourdes and Rocco.

 

"How so sweet this woman is!" said Lucy Chipeta, director of Home of Hope Orphanage in Mchinji, where Madonna adopted son David in 2006, as more than 500 children scrambled for toys and bars of chocolate.

 

Near another orphanage, Consol Homes, more than 1,000 people from surrounding villages were invited to an open-air party.

 

"Madonna says she always enjoys the traditional dances the villagers perform for her when she visits," said Yacinta Chapomba, director of Consol Homes.

 

"She asked us to invite as many villagers as possible for the Christmas party," she added. (ANI)
